Ways to get around Jacksonville

Walking

Walking in Jacksonville can be a pleasant way to explore certain areas, but it is not the most practical option for getting around the entire city. As the largest city by land area in the U.S., Jacksonville’s sprawling layout means that many destinations are spread out and not easily accessible on foot. However, neighborhoods like Downtown, Riverside, Avondale, and San Marco are more walkable, offering a mix of parks, shops, and restaurants within close proximity. The city’s warm climate can make walking enjoyable during cooler months, though the heat and humidity in summer may be less comfortable for extended walks.

Biking

For those considering biking, Jacksonville offers some infrastructure, including bike lanes and paths, but the city’s large size and spread-out layout can make biking less practical for reaching certain destinations. While some areas are accessible by bike, distances between key locations may be significant, which could be a challenge for daily commuting. The flat terrain is generally favorable for biking, but the lack of extensive dedicated bike lanes in some areas may require caution when sharing roads with vehicles.

Car

Driving is one of the most convenient ways to navigate Jacksonville, thanks to its car-friendly infrastructure and extensive network of roads and highways. The city’s infrastructure supports car travel with well-maintained streets and ample parking options in many areas. Traffic can be moderate to heavy during peak hours, but overall, driving is manageable. The city’s layout, with its spread-out neighborhoods and attractions, makes a car particularly useful for covering longer distances. Weather conditions are generally favorable for driving, though occasional rain may require caution.

Public Transit

Public transportation in Jacksonville includes bus services and a downtown people mover system, offering options for those without a car. The bus network covers many areas, including routes to the beaches, making it a practical choice for reaching key destinations. The downtown people mover provides a convenient way to navigate the city center. However, the city’s large size and spread-out layout can make some areas less accessible by public transit alone. Additionally, the weather can impact comfort while waiting for or transferring between services, as many stops may lack shelter. Public transit is best suited for those traveling within well-served areas.

Ferry

The St. Johns River Ferry in Jacksonville offers a convenient and scenic way to cross the river, connecting Mayport Village and Fort George Island. Departing every 30 minutes, the ferry accommodates pedestrians, cyclists, and vehicles, making it a versatile option for various travelers. The crossing typically takes about 10 minutes, providing a quick and efficient route. While the ferry is a great way to access certain areas, its utility depends on your destination, as it primarily serves specific points along the river. Weather and traffic conditions may occasionally impact schedules, but overall, it is a reliable transportation choice.
